Assisted living facilities in Gloucester, Massachusetts, offer a variety of services and amenities to cater to the needs and preferences of seniors seeking a comfortable and supportive living environment. These facilities prioritize the well-being and independence of their residents, making them an attractive option for those in their golden years. Gloucester, located in Essex County, is regulated by the Massachusetts Executive Office of Elder Affairs, ensuring that assisted living facilities meet the necessary standards and licensing requirements.
Among the services and amenities provided by assisted living facilities in Gloucester, you can expect assistance with daily activities such as bathing, dressing, and medication management. Staff members are trained to provide personalized care plans to meet individual needs. Transportation services are also available for residents who wish to explore the scenic beauty of Gloucester or visit nearby cities like Rockport and Manchester-by-the-Sea, all within a short drive from Gloucester.
In addition to essential care services, assisted living facilities in Gloucester often offer a range of recreational activities to keep residents engaged and socially active. These may include fitness programs, arts and crafts, gardening, and even pet-friendly environments for those with furry companions. Many facilities provide dining options that cater to dietary preferences and offer restaurant-style meals, ensuring residents have access to nutritious and delicious food.
For those seeking luxury services, some assisted living communities in Gloucester offer upscale amenities such as spa treatments, concierge services, and private transportation for outings and appointments. These luxury features elevate the living experience, providing seniors with a sense of comfort and extravagance in their retirement years.

Assisted living facilities are residential communities that provide support and assistance to seniors with activities of daily living, such as bathing, dressing, medication management, and meal preparation. These facilities offer a combination of independence and care tailored to residents' needs.
Assisted living facilities in Gloucester commonly offer services like personal care assistance, housekeeping, laundry, meal services, medication management, transportation, social activities, and 24-hour staff availability to ensure residents' comfort and well-being.
Gloucester assisted living homes might be the right choice if you or your loved one requires assistance with daily tasks, desires a supportive community, and values having access to care while maintaining independence.
When choosing an assisted living facility in Gloucester, consider factors such as location, cost, services offered, staff qualifications, facility cleanliness, safety measures, resident testimonials, and the overall atmosphere. Visiting the facility in person and asking detailed questions can help you make an informed decision.
Assisted living facilities in Gloucester typically provide assistance with activities of daily living and medication management. While they are not equipped to provide extensive medical care, many facilities have trained staff who can help residents with medication administration and coordinate medical appointments with healthcare providers.
In many assisted living facilities, residents are allowed to bring their own furniture and personal belongings to make their living space feel like home. However, it's recommended to check with the specific Gloucester facility you are considering regarding size limitations, safety considerations, and any guidelines for personal items.
Assisted living facilities in Gloucester typically offer meal services in communal dining areas. Meals are often prepared on-site and can cater to various dietary preferences and restrictions. Some facilities may also offer options for in-room dining or snacks throughout the day.
Many assisted living facilities in Gloucester provide transportation services for residents to attend medical appointments, go shopping, and participate in social activities. This transportation can help residents maintain their independence and engage with the community outside the facility.
Yes, most Gloucester assisted living communities offer a range of social activities, such as group outings, fitness classes, art and craft sessions, entertainment events, and educational programs. These activities are designed to promote social interaction, mental stimulation, and overall well-being among residents.
Absolutely! It's highly recommended to visit and tour assisted living facilities you're considering. A visit allows you to see the environment, ask the right questions, interact with staff and residents, ask questions, and assess whether the facility aligns with your expectations and needs. Many Gloucester facilities offer guided tours for prospective residents and their families.
The costs of Gloucester assisted living can be covered through various means, including personal savings, pensions, Social Security benefits, retirement accounts, long-term care insurance, and government assistance programs like Medicaid. Exploring different financial options and planning ahead can help you manage the expenses of assisted living.
Before moving to assisted living in Gloucester, consider factors such as your healthcare needs, personal preferences, budget, location, and the level of assistance required. Talk to family members, healthcare providers, and facility staff to ensure a smooth transition and a suitable living arrangement.
The admission process to assisted living facilities in Gloucester typically involves an initial assessment of the prospective resident's needs, preferences, and medical history. This assessment helps determine the level of care required. Once the assessment is complete and the facility is chosen, the resident and their family review the contract, including costs, services, and policies. After signing the contract, a move-in date is scheduled, and the facility staff assists with the transition and settling into the new living arrangement.
